微信小程序弹幕攻击通过什么实现?
最近小程序又更新了新的功能,那就是微信小程序弹幕攻击功能,这到底是通过什么实现的呢?不少用户和小程序开发者对此表示非常好奇和感兴趣。小编查阅了相关资料之后才知道这是通过小程序视频控件实现的。那么接下来就为大家具体介绍一下:
video是小程序中用于播放视频的控件,和音频控件一致,它提供了简单易用的视频控制插件和API。注意:video标签默认宽度是300px,高度为225px,通过wxss设置width和height卡可以调整宽度和高度。在新建小程序项目中view视图编辑代码:
在JS文件中编辑代码,这里定义了一个getRandomColor方法,用来区分不同小程序弹幕的颜色:
更改wxss样式文件,让整个视图变得更美观:
保存上述代码运行效果图如图所示,单击“播放”按钮可以播放在线视频,弹幕按钮可以关闭或者开启弹幕选项,在下方的弹幕输入框中输入想要发送的内容,就可以发送弹幕了。使用video标签引入一个在线的视频和自带的播放器,就可实现视频的播放操作。在JS文件中定义一个数组用来模拟存储已有的弹幕信息,同时在发送按钮上绑定监听事件,当用户单击按钮的时候调用sendFanmu发送即时的弹幕信息。
注意:对于联网的应用可以根据小程序API拿到相关的弹幕信息,并且在JS中对弹幕进行格式化处理,交由wxml显示。而对用户实时输入的弹幕信息,除了在视频上显示以外,还需要通过相应的API上传到服务器中进行持久化的存储。
以上就是关于微信小程序弹幕攻击实现的全部内容了,看完之后你会发现,原来使用小程序弹幕就是通过小程序视频控件实现的,并没有想象中的复杂嘛,大家快来试试这个新功能吧!更多相关资料请关注微信小程序商店。
究竟手持弹幕小程序编辑的内容如何分享在朋友圈?
怎样才能使用微信小程序弹幕攻击?
微信小程序视频弹幕效果和设置方法
上一篇:藏语字母通
下一篇:微信小程序布局标签有哪些?
